CHICAGO (WBBM NEWSRADIO) — Wrigleyville Ald. Tom Tunney, the owner of Ann Sather Restaurant & Catering, admitted to making an “error in judgment” by allowing some indoor dining while state and local regulations prohibit it. He now faces a possible fine.

After the Second City Cop blog revealed that the restaurant let some customers inside to eat, Ald. Tunney issued a written statement reading, “On a sporadic basis, we have allowed a very limited number of our regular diners to eat inside the restaurant while observing social distancing and mask-wearing rules. This was error in judgement and won’t happen again.”

Effective Oct. 30, Governor Pritzker enforced a statewide ban on indoor bar in an effort to reduce the spread of COVID-19.

Governor Pritzker reacted Monday to the news.

“I agree it was an error in judgment. I will also say that elected officials should be setting the example. Not creating the example that people may follow that will spread coronavirus. We have mitigations in place for a reason. We have asked everybody to follow them, and frankly, most restaurants and bars have followed them. They're doing the right thing. I think that the alderman has said properly that it was an error in judgment and I think it was a tremendous one...The double standard is the people out there that think that they don't have to follow the rules."

Mayor Lightfoot’s office released a statement on Tunney’s restaurant violation reading, “Any business found in violation of these guidelines has been and will be held fully accountable. No exceptions."

The city’s department of Business Affairs and Consumer Protection said Ann Sather was one of many restaurants that received an outreach call, making sure it was aware of COVID-19 rules.

The department said this matter is under investigation and could result in citations against Tunney’s restaurant.

Ann Sather's three restaurant locations are on the North Side.
